学生A: 嗨,小明,我最近对大数据分析很感兴趣,特别是在大学里的应用。你能给我讲讲吗?
小明: 当然可以!首先,你需要了解的是大数据分析系统是如何帮助大学进行研究和教学的。比如,我们可以利用数据分析来改善课程设计。
学生A: 这听起来很酷!那我们怎么开始呢?
小明: 首先,我们需要收集一些数据。比如说,我们可以从学生的考试成绩、选课偏好等信息入手。这些数据可以从学校的数据库或者学习管理系统中获取。
学生A: 好的,那接下来呢?
小明: 接下来就是数据处理阶段。我们需要清洗数据,去除错误或不完整的记录。这一步很重要,因为不干净的数据会影响我们的分析结果。这里有一个简单的Python代码示例:
import pandas as pd
# 加载数据
data = pd.read_csv('students_data.csv')
# 清洗数据
data_cleaned = data.dropna()
]]>
学生A: 明白了,然后呢?
小明: 然后是数据分析阶段。我们可以使用各种算法来发现数据中的模式。比如,我们可以用K-means聚类算法来识别不同群体的学生。下面是一个简单的例子:
from sklearn.cluster import KMeans
# 假设我们已经处理好了数据
features = data_cleaned[['score', 'hours_studied']]
# 应用K-means算法
kmeans = KMeans(n_clusters=3)
kmeans.fit(features)
# 查看结果
data_cleaned['cluster'] = kmeans.labels_
]]>
学生A: 太棒了,这样我们就能够根据不同的学习习惯和成绩将学生分组了!
小明: 没错!这只是一个简单的例子,实际应用中会更复杂。但通过这种方式,大学可以更好地理解学生的需求,从而提供更有针对性的教学和服务。